OBIT: Mrs. Anna T Rock, 47, wife of Frank Rock, yardmaster for the Big Four railroad, died Friday morning at 2:20 o'clock at St Elizabeth Hospital where she was taken Thursday evening at 8:30 o'clock. Mrs. Rock had been ailing since Christmas, death was due to pleurisy and heart trouble. The family residence is at 1115 Central Street. Born in Lafayette, Sept 21, 1884, she was the daughter of the late Mr. and Mrs. Patrick Alwell, former well known residents of the First ward. Her entire life was spent in this city. She was a member of St Mary's Catholic church. With the husband she leaves two daughters, Marian and Veronica Rock, both at home and two sisters, Mrs. Minnie Potter and Miss Kate Alwell of this city. A brother Patrick Alwell city street commissioner, died Jan 17, 1932. The body was removed to the Vianco funeral home and will be returned to the family residence Friday afternoon, where friends may call. Funeral services will be conducted Mon morning at 9 o'clock from St Marys Catholic church. Interment in St Mary's cemetery.
